Molecular Formula: C3H6N4O3 Molecular Weight: 146.11 HS Code: 2924190002
Description : Triuret is a byproduct of purine degradation in living organisms. - Molecular Weight :146.11
- Melting Point :> 226°C (dec.)
Molecular Formula : C3H6N4O3 Canonical SMILES : C(=O)(N)NC(=O)NC(=O)N InChI : InChI=1S/C3H6N4O3/c4-1(8)6-3(10)7-2(5)9/h(H6,4,5,6,7,8,9,10) InChIKey : WNVQBUHCOYRLPA-UHFFFAOYSA-N Appearance : White to Pale Yellow Solid Synonyms : Diimidotricarbonic diamide; Carbonyldiurea; Dicarbamylurea
